Rabbinical College of Ohr Shimon Yisroel is a private, faith-based seminary located in Brooklyn, New York, focused exclusively on theological education and training for religious vocations within the Jewish tradition. The college serves a small, dedicated student body in an urban setting.
The college enrolls 233 students and charges $22,200 annually in tuition, with a total cost of attendance of $25,200 including room and board. This pricing structure is consistent for both in-state and out-of-state students.
This institution is appropriate for students seeking intensive religious study and preparation for rabbinic ordination and leadership roles.
